About

Kedington, Hundon and Withersfield sit on the outskirts of Haverhill in West Suffolk, set into an agricultural landscape of arable fields, hedgerows and country lanes. Each village is centred on a parish church and a handful of older houses and farmsteads, with footpaths linking fields and small copses. From public rights of way you can spot traces of ridge-and-furrow in meadowland and stone- and flint-built church towers that mark the parishes from a distance. Narrow lanes thread between cottages and barns, and small village greens and halls provide focal points for local events.

Everyday life in the area revolves around farming, local services and short commutes to nearby towns. Hundon and Kedington retain village shops, a pub or two and community-run facilities, while Withersfield is quieter and more dispersed around its lanes. Parish councils organise fetes, maintenance of footpaths and conservation of hedgerows, and local volunteers run groups from sports clubs to historical societies, keeping community routines and the pattern of rural lanes and fields familiar to residents.

Area overview

On average Kedington, Hundon & Withersfield has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 51 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 7.7%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Kedington, Hundon & Withersfield is £59,790 per year. There are 5 schools in Kedington, Hundon & Withersfield: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 3 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Kedington, Hundon & Withersfield is home to around 8,253 people, with a population density of about 75.3 per km2.

Property prices in Kedington, Hundon & Withersfield

Based on 112 recent sales, the median property price is £367,750 in Kedington, Hundon & Withersfield area, with individual transactions ranging from £170,000 up to £1,200,000.
